This listing is for a beautiful Roseville Pottery Vase. It has a blue and green mottled glaze and a Roseville Pottery paper label on the bottom. The only other marking on the bottom is the handwritten number 550. Roseville patterns produced between 1927 and 1935 were marked with only paper or foil labels. The vase measures 7.25 inches tall and is in very good condition with no chips, cracks or repairs. There are several small imperfections in the glaze.
